Juniper Pruning Questions
What is juniper pruning? Juniper pruning involves trimming and shaping juniper bushes to promote healthy growth and maintain desired size and form.
When is the best time to prune junipers? The best time to prune junipers is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
Why should junipers be pruned regularly? Regular pruning helps remove dead or overgrown branches, improves appearance, and encourages fuller, healthier growth.
Can juniper pruning help prevent pests and diseases? Yes, pruning can improve airflow and remove infected or damaged branches, reducing the risk of pests and diseases.
